A Conversion Could Allow You to Help UT and Yourself The thought-provoking article suggests that converting a traditional IRA to a Roth IRA in 2010 could enable you to help UT and maximize what your heirs will receive. Many commentators have suggested that pairing charitable gifts from non-IRA assets with converting a traditional IRA to a Roth IRA in 2010 may offer significant tax savings and long-term benefits to your heirs. The September 2010 issue of Trusts and Estates magazine contains a thought-provoking article about the outcomes of nine alternative ways to support charitable causes and maximize what is left from IRAs for heirs: "Are IRAs and Charities the Perfect Match?" If you have already converted a traditional IRA to a Roth IRA or are considering doing so before the end of 2010, you will want to share the article with your professional advisers as soon as possible.
